Ensuring Optimal Solar Power Performance

One of the primary goals of solar O&M is to ensure that solar power plants operate at their maximum efficiency. This involves regular inspections, cleaning, and preventive maintenance of the solar panels and system components. Dust, dirt, and debris can accumulate on the surface of solar modules, significantly reducing their ability to absorb sunlight and generate electricity. Regular solar maintenance helps maintain peak performance and ensures the plant produces the maximum possible clean energy.

Early Detection of System Issues

Routine inspections and continuous monitoring are essential components of effective solar O&M strategies. By regularly checking the condition of solar panels, inverters, and other key parts, potential issues can be identified early before they escalate into costly problems. Early detection of issues—such as micro-cracks, hot spots, or inverter malfunctions—can prevent unexpected repairs and downtime, ensuring uninterrupted power production.

Maximizing the Lifespan of Solar Power Plants

Solar power plants are significant investments, and maximizing their lifespan is crucial for achieving a strong return on investment. Proper solar operations and maintenance practices help extend the life of the solar panels and other infrastructure, keeping performance levels high for years. This includes not only cleaning and inspections but also the timely replacement of worn-out components and upgrades to newer, more efficient technologies as they become available.

Enhancing Safety and Compliance

Safety is a critical aspect of any solar power plant operation. Regular O&M activities help identify and mitigate potential hazards, such as loose wiring, damaged equipment, or structural issues. By addressing these risks promptly, the likelihood of accidents and equipment failures is greatly reduced. This ensures a safe working environment for maintenance teams and helps maintain compliance with regulatory standards.

Improving Financial Performance

Efficient solar operations and maintenance practices have a direct impact on the financial performance of solar power plants. By maintaining high efficiency and reducing downtime, plants can generate more electricity and, as a result, more revenue. Proactive maintenance also helps avoid expensive emergency repairs and prolongs equipment lifespan, lowering operational costs. This improved financial performance makes solar energy projects more attractive to investors and stakeholders.
